<p style="text-align: left;">I noticed this classic grammar clanger on a promo for ER on television the other week:</p>
<p style="text-align: center;"><img class="aligncenter" title="DSCF5123" src="http://emilybwebb.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/03/DSCF51232-300x225.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></p>
<p>I can remember my first weekly grammar test for my journalism course at university. I made this mistake too and my lecturer Sally White,  wrote &#8220;Sally sitting down because Sally feels ill&#8221; and she drew a little picture of her sitting in a chair with head stooped.</p>
<p>I have never forgotten the proper use of its and it&#8217;s again.</p>
<p>An easy way I would tell the kids I taught was to think whether they would say, &#8220;the dog wags it is (it&#8217;s) tail&#8221; or &#8220;the dog wags its tail&#8221;.</p>
